Federal government inks $400m deal with Nauru to resettle people who have ‘no legal right to stay in Australia’
The Albanese government will pay Nauru more than $408 million to resettle hundreds of non-citizens caught up in the High Court’s NZYQ decision after the home affairs minister signed a deal in an unannounced visit to the Micronesian nation on Friday.
